Alogliptin and Phenytoin Interaction
Drug interaction information between Alogliptin and Phenytoin.
Alogliptin and Phenytoin have a documented minor interaction in FDA labeling.
FDA drug labeling documents a minor-severity interaction between Alogliptin and Phenytoin. This page displays the available source-record category and label text. The category is not an individual risk estimate or medication-combination direction.
How They Interact
Phenytoin can affect blood sugar levels, which might change how well your diabetes medicine works.
